Understanding Laser Skin Rejuvenation

Laser skin rejuvenation has rapidly become a transformative option for individuals looking to combat the signs of aging, such as wrinkles and sun damage. This non-invasive method works by targeting skin imperfections and promoting the production of collagen, a protein crucial for maintaining skin elasticity and firmness.

There are various types of laser treatments, each tailored to different skin concerns and recovery time preferences, including fractional, ablative, and non-ablative lasers. These treatments can effectively reduce age spots, fine lines, and even scars, offering a smoother and more youthful appearance.

Types of Laser Treatments

Laser resurfacing treatments can be divided into three main categories: ablative, non-ablative, and fractional lasers. Ablative lasers, such as CO2 and Er:YAG, remove the outer layers of skin and are effective for deep wrinkles and significant sun damage. While they offer dramatic results, they also come with a longer healing period.

Alternatively, non-ablative lasers work beneath the skin’s surface, stimulating collagen production for skin tightening without significant downtime. Fractional lasers create micro-injuries that promote healing, balancing the effects and recovery time allowing quick recovery while still being effective.

Benefits of Laser Skin Rejuvenation

The primary advantage of laser skin rejuvenation is its ability to significantly improve skin tone, texture, and elasticity. This improvement is largely due to the stimulation of collagen, which is critical for maintaining skin’s youthful appearance.

Some laser treatments also target specific issues like pigmentation, redness, and scars. These procedures are particularly beneficial for seniors, helping to reduce age-related skin issues by enhancing collagen production through photon absorption.

Choosing the Right Treatment

Selecting the appropriate laser treatment depends on several factors, including skin type, specific skin concerns, and personal preferences. For those concerned about downtime, non-ablative lasers could be a suitable choice due to their minimal recovery needs.

Meanwhile, individuals looking for more comprehensive results might opt for ablative lasers. It’s important to consult with a dermatologist who can assess individual needs and customize a treatment plan accordingly through a personalized consultation.

Considerations for Laser Skin Rejuvenation

Before undergoing laser skin rejuvenation, it is crucial to consider potential risks and side effects. These can include pigmentation changes, infection, and in rare cases, scarring. People with darker skin tones may need to take extra precautions, as certain lasers can affect melanin differently.

It is always advisable to follow pre- and post-treatment guidelines provided by healthcare professionals to minimize these risks. Furthermore, laser skin treatments are elective and often not covered by insurance, so financial planning is also a necessity.
